AmaZulu FC sign five players ahead of 2024-25 season
AmaZulu FC have announced the signings of Kwanda Mngonyama, Boniface Haba, Senzo Ndlovu, Luvuyo Phewa & Etiosa Ighodaro.
AmaZulu FC’s statement said: “In preparation for the 2024/25 Betway Premiership, head coach Pablo Franco’s squad is strengthened by the permanent signings of defender Kwanda Mngonyama, striker Senzo Ndlovu, and winger Boniface Haba.
“Additionally, attacking midfielder Luvuyo Phewa and striker Etioso Ighodaro join on loan from Mamelodi Sundowns. Promising talents Thato Matli and Leonardo Rooi also join the green and white army, although they are set to finalize loan moves for further development elsewhere.”
